A gap between the frame of the sash and the frame could be the cause of your uPVC windows not closing properly. This problem can cause draughts, however it could also cause dampness and water damage. To determine this, try putting a piece of paper between the frame and the sash to see if the frame can be closed.

To fix the issue, you'll need to take off the seals surrounding the frame and the sash. You'll then have to remove the locking mechanism from its place inside the frame. To open the gearbox, you will need a flat screwdriver or torch. After you have removed the gearbox, you'll have to replace it with a brand new one that is the same model and size.

UPVC window frame repair

It is essential to repair any holes, cracks or broken seals on your uPVC Windows as quickly as possible. These issues can cause the glass of your windows to get cloudy and may also lead water leaks. The frames can also be damaged, reducing the insulation value and causing higher energy bills. Luckily, most of these issues can be repaired with some easy DIY repairs or by hiring an experienced professional.

UPVC window repair is more efficient than replacing the entire window. However, there are some cases where it's more beneficial to replace the entire unit. This is especially true when the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of the UPVC replacement window is determined by a variety of factors, such as the type of material and the amount of work involved. A full replacement costs between $100 and $1,000 per window, and the cost will vary based on the severity of the damage as well as whether replacement is required.

Typically, repairing an UPVC window involves taking out the frame and sash and cleaning the jambs and sills and replacing the old sealing materials with new ones. The cost will vary depending on the type of window you own and the condition of it.

A leaky UPVC is caused by various factors, including weather conditions or general wear and wear and tear. These factors can cause the window to be warped or damaged. The damage could be costly to repair, which is why it is important to seek out a qualified expert to complete the task.

Another issue that is common is water condensation between glass panes of your double-glazed UPVC windows. This can occur when the frames of the windows aren't properly fitted or when the nail fins have become loose and are not able to provide a reliable seal. A specialist in uPVC repair will replace the seals and ensure that the window is sealed which will prevent drafts and improve energy efficiency.
